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1817 300 31061722657 52841605590
455 27129603
455 27129603
777899 09068 47928 32039552401 46267
All about undefined
Interested in learning more?
455 27129603
777899 09068 47928 32039552401 46267
See more
5618 5777132681
7919 57 16775985796
See more
134 4608
57749401671 65813 01918 80
See more